In a disheartening incident highlighting ongoing prejudices, transgender hairdresser Watchara “Emmy” U-phat shared her experience of being unfoundedly accused of potentially spreading HIV by a client and her mother. Despite Emmy being HIV negative, the accusations stemmed from stereotypes about transgender individuals.

The Department of Special Investigation (DSI) has launched an investigation into a private airstrip allegedly constructed over public land in Khanong Phra Subdistrict, Pak Chong District, Nakhon Ratchasima. The 1-kilometre runway is suspected of being built without official permission and in violation of public land use regulations.
